I have two acerola cherry trees that have very sweet juicy fruit when ripe (dark red) that do remind me of cherries. They don't stay on the tree very long. If the dogs are out in that area I have to watch them because they will sniff out the ripe berries on the branches and eat them - all of them they can reach! I thought all acerola/barbados cherry trees produced sweet fruit. Are there different varieties? I ask because I saw them at Home Depot and recommended them to a friend. If there are different varieties, I want to warn her. I bought mine at Excalibur
